  9. #if NET_2_0
  10. using System;
  11. using System.IO;
  12. using System.Text;
  13. using NUnit.Framework;
  14. namespace MonoTests.System.Text
  15. {
  16. [TestFixture]
  17. public class EncoderReplacementFallbackTest
  18. {
  19. [Test]
  20. public void Defaults ()
  21. {
  22. EncoderReplacementFallback f =
  23. new EncoderReplacementFallback ();
  24. Assert.AreEqual ("?", f.DefaultString, "#1");
  25. Assert.AreEqual (1, f.MaxCharCount, "#2");
  26. f = new EncoderReplacementFallback (String.Empty);
  27. Assert.AreEqual (String.Empty, f.DefaultString, "#3");
  28. Assert.AreEqual (0, f.MaxCharCount, "#4");
  29. f = Encoding.UTF8.EncoderFallback as EncoderReplacementFallback;
  30. Assert.IsNotNull (f, "#5");
  31. Assert.AreEqual (String.Empty, f.DefaultString, "#6");
  32. Assert.AreEqual (0, f.MaxCharCount, "#7");
  33. // after beta2 this test became invalid.
  34. //f = new MyEncoding ().EncoderFallback as EncoderReplacementFallback;
  35. //Assert.IsNotNull (f, "#8");
  36. //Assert.AreEqual (String.Empty, f.DefaultString, "#9");
  37. //Assert.AreEqual (0, f.MaxCharCount, "#10");
  38. f = EncoderFallback.ReplacementFallback as EncoderReplacementFallback;
  39. Assert.AreEqual ("?", f.DefaultString, "#11");
  40. Assert.AreEqual (1, f.MaxCharCount, "#12");
  41. }
  42. [Test]
  43. [ExpectedException (typeof (InvalidOperationException))]
  44. public void DontChangeReadOnlyUTF8EncoderFallback ()
  45. {
  46. Encoding.UTF8.EncoderFallback =
  47. new EncoderReplacementFallback ();
  48. }
  49. [Test]
  50. [ExpectedException (typeof (InvalidOperationException))]
  51. public void DontChangeReadOnlyCodePageEncoderFallback ()
  52. {
  53. Encoding.GetEncoding (932).EncoderFallback =
  54. new EncoderReplacementFallback ();
  55. }
  56. [Test]
  57. [ExpectedException (typeof (InvalidOperationException))]
  58. public void CustomEncodingSetEncoderFallback ()
  59. {
  60. new MyEncoding ().EncoderFallback =
  61. new EncoderReplacementFallback ();
  62. }
  63. [Test]
  64. [ExpectedException (typeof (InvalidOperationException))]
  65. public void EncodingSetNullEncoderFallback ()
  66. {
  67. Encoding.Default.EncoderFallback = null;
  68. }
  69. [Test]
  70. // Don't throw an exception
  71. public void SetEncoderFallback ()
  72. {
  73. Encoding.Default.GetEncoder ().Fallback =
  74. new EncoderReplacementFallback ();
  75. }
  76. [Test]
  77. [ExpectedException (typeof (ArgumentNullException))]
  78. public void EncoderSetNullFallback ()
  79. {
  80. Encoding.Default.GetEncoder ().Fallback = null;
  81. }
  82. [Test]
  83. public void Latin1Replacement ()
  84. // coz Latin1 is easy single byte encoding.
  85. {
  86. Encoding enc = Encoding.GetEncoding (28591); // Latin1
  87. byte [] reference = new byte [] {0x58, 0x58, 0x3F, 0x3F, 0x3F, 0x5A, 0x5A};
  88. byte [] bytes = enc.GetBytes ("XX\u3007\u4E00\u9780ZZ");
  89. Assert.AreEqual (reference, bytes, "#1");
  90. }
  91. }
  92. }
  93. #endif
